Understanding Vision Modification Surgical Treatment: Kinds and Strategies
When you think about vision modification surgery, it's vital to understand the numerous types and techniques readily available. One of the most usual alternatives include LASIK, PRK, and implantable lenses. LASIK utilizes a laser to improve the cornea, providing quick healing and minimal pain. PRK, on the other hand, eliminates the surface layer of the cornea prior to reshaping it, which might take longer to heal however is suitable for those with thinner corneas. Implantable lenses entail placing a lens inside the eye, offering a remedy for those that aren't candidates for LASIK or PRK Each technique has its unique advantages and considerations, so discussing these alternatives with your eye treatment expert is important to discover the best suitable for your vision needs.
Examining the Safety and Efficiency of LASIK and PRK.
Both LASIK and PRK are preferred options for vision correction, however evaluating their security and performance is key to making a notified decision. LASIK utilizes a laser to reshape the cornea and is understood for its fast healing and minimal pain. However, some patients may experience dry eyes or aesthetic disturbances post-surgery. PRK, on the other hand, entails eliminating the external layer of the cornea, advertising all-natural healing. While it might take longer to recuperate compared to LASIK, it's commonly suggested for those with thinner corneas. Both procedures have high success prices, however specific results can differ. Consulting with your eye treatment specialist can assist you understand the most effective alternative based on your distinct circumstances and vision demands.
Lasting Considerations and Effects of Vision Correction Surgical Treatment
While vision adjustment surgical procedure can significantly boost your eyesight, it's important to consider the lasting implications of these treatments. You might experience modifications in your vision in time, even after a successful surgery. Conditions like presbyopia can still happen, needing you to adjust to reading glasses later. In addition, some individuals report completely dry eyes or halos around lights, which may persist. It's crucial to preserve regular check-ups with your eye care specialist to check your eye health and wellness. Moreover, the financial investment in surgical procedure need to be considered versus prospective future expenses for enhancements or treatments.
